Примечания (кликните для просмотра)
Cокращения в названиях колонок таблицы:
Ветер на высоте 10 м над земной поверхностью (направление ветра указано в градусах горизонта, откуда дует) - SFC WIND
Метры в секунду - MPS
Максимальные порывы ветра при грозе (шквал) - SQ
Приземная дальность видимости (на высоте 1.5-6 м; во второй строке указывается видимость в локальных ливневых осадках) - SFC VIS
Явления погоды - WX
Метры над поверхностью земли (воды) - M AGL
Облачность нижнего яруса и вертикального развития - CLD L
Облачность среднего и верхнего ярусов - CLD M
Уровень замерзания (нулевая изотерма) - FZLVL
Обледенение - ICE
Турбулентность - TURB
Температура воздуха на высоте 2 м над поверхностью - SFC T
Tочка росы на высоте 2 м над поверхностью - SFC TD
Относительная влажность воздуха на высоте 2 м над поверхностью - SFC RH
Атмосферное давление на среднем уровне моря, приведённое по стандартной атмосфере - QNH
Ветер, температура воздуха и точка росы по высотам - WIND/T/TD
Количество осадков (в первой строке общее количество, во второй конвективные осадки повсеместные (преобладающее количество), в третьей конвективные осадки локальные (максимальное количество)) - APCP
Индексы гроз: Вайтинг, Фауст, LI - K F LI
Вероятность грозы в радиусе 100 км от точки - PTS
Толщина пограничного слоя, характеристики приземного слоя (вертикальная скорость, лапласиан геопотенциала), относительный вихрь в приземном слое и пограничном слое - HPBL DZDTsurf HLAPsurf RELVsurf RELVpbl
Цвет рамки ячейки в правой колонке означает условия (высота нижней границы облаков х видимость):
зелёный - VFR (выше 900х8000);
голубой - MVFR (ниже 900х8000, но не ниже 300х5000);
красный - IFR (ниже 300х5000, но не ниже 150х2000);
пурпурный - LIFR (ниже 150х2000, но не ниже 90х800);
фиолетовый - VLIFR (ниже 90х800).
Для каждого облачного слоя указана (через дробную черту) его нижняя и верхняя граница (в метрах над средним уровнем рельефа местности).
Количество облаков в данном слое обозначается:
FEW - незначительная, 1-3 балла* (1-2 октанта);
SCT - рассеянная (разбросанная), 4-5 баллов* (3-4 октанта);
BKN - разорванная (значительная), 6-9 баллов* (5-7 октантов);
OVC - сплошная, 10 баллов* (8 октантов).
Для количества кучево-дождевых и мощных кучевых облаков используются термины:
ISOL - изолированная, 1-4 балла* (1-3 октанта);
OCNL - редкая, 5-7 баллов* (4-6 октантов);
FRQ - частая, 8-10 баллов* (6-8 октантов).
* 1 балл = 1/10 небосвода, 1 октант = 1/8 небосвода.
Формы облаков:
CI - перистая, CS - перисто-слоистая, AC - высоко-кучевая, AS - высоко-слоистая, SC - слоисто-кучевая, ST - слоистая,
NS - слоисто-дождевая, CU - кучевая, TCU - мощная кучевая, CB - кучево-дождевая.
